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1371630 0020711071 3578781495
05768 63241539 380
05768 63241539 380
7445454 75179671164 23 5352447855
All about undefined
Interested in learning more?
05768 63241539 380
7445454 75179671164 23 5352447855
See more
00 253
34169 199 0813
See more
26182 38487 3648653472
743 30 081962 21019079421
See more